Use of the AdS/CFT correspondence to arrive at phenomenological gauge field theories is discussed, focusing on the orbifolded case without supersymmetry. An abelian orbifold with the finite group Z_p can give rise to a G = U(N)^p gauge group with chiral fermions and complex scalars in different bi-fundamental representations of G. The naturalness issue is discussed, particularly the absence of quadratic divergences in the scalar propagator at one loop. This requires that the scalars all be in bi-fundamentals with no adjoints, coincident with the necessary and sufficient condition for presence of chiral fermions. Speculations are made concerning new gauge and matter particles expected soon to be pursued experimentally at the LHC.
